What is Papua New Guinea Kina (PGK)

The Papua New Guinea kina (PGK) is the official currency of Papua New Guinea, a country located in Oceania. Introduced in 1975, the PGK replaced the Australian dollar at a rate of 2 kina for each Australian dollar. The currency is named after the term "kina," which refers to a traditional shell used as currency by some of the indigenous people of Papua New Guinea.

The currency code for kina is PGK, and it is divided into 100 toea. The Central Bank of Papua New Guinea is the authority that manages the PGK, ensuring that monetary policies are in place for economic stability. Fluctuations in the value of the PGK are influenced by various factors such as commodity prices, inflation, and the economic performance of the country.

Converting BAM to PGK

When converting BAM to PGK, it is essential to check the current exchange rates, as they can fluctuate significantly due to market conditions. The conversion rate can be expressed mathematically as:

PGK = BAM × Exchange Rate

Where the exchange rate is the amount of PGK that one BAM can buy.

To convert a specific amount, you would multiply the number of BAM by the prevailing exchange rate. For example, if the exchange rate is 1 BAM = 1.5 PGK, and you have 10 BAM, your conversion would be:

PGK = 10 BAM × 1.5 PGK/BAM = 15 PGK

Seeking current exchange rates can be done through various financial websites, currency converters, or by contacting banks. It's always wise to take into account any fees or commissions that may apply when converting currencies, as these can affect the final amount received.
